Default Breaking Volvo 144

Now that I have sold my Volvo 142 I no longer need the 144 I bought for spares to support it. I acquired it for the entire suspension and steering setup.

It is a very late automatic (no quarter light windows, interior like a 240) ; it is all there except grill and one front wing, but the back end is smashed in.
It is a big bumper model and the engine is probably spoken for.
The car is located inland from Bognor in a private space next to my lockups.

All glass is there, doors are decent, red trim is decent. I shall be stripping it in the next couple of weeks or so : does anybody want any bits?
